| Labfans是一个针对大学生、工程师和科研工作者的技术社区。 | 论坛首页 | 联系我们(Contact Us) | 
![]()  | 
	
| 
	 | 
| 		
			
			 | 
		#1 | 
| 
			
			 初级会员 
			
			
			
			注册日期: 2008-05-15 
				
				年龄: 38 
				
					帖子: 1
				 
				
				
				声望力: 0 ![]()  | 
	
	
	
		
		
			
			 
			
			s=solve('x+y+z=1','x*y+y*z+z=3','x^2+y^2-z^2=1'); 
		
		
		
		
		
		
			为什么会得到 x=-3,1,1 y=1,i*3^(1/2),-i*3^(1/2) z=3,-i*3^(1/2),i*3^(1/2) 这三个解?? 而且-3 1 3 根本就不是本方程组的解 而最简单的1 1 1这个解却没有得到 为什么? 
				__________________ 
		
		
		
		
	每天进步~  | 
| 
		 | 
	
	
	
		
		
		
		
			 
		
		
		
		
		
		
		
			
		
		
		
	 | 
| 		
			
			 | 
		#2 | 
| 
			
			 初级会员 
			
			
			
			注册日期: 2008-03-23 
				
				年龄: 42 
				
					帖子: 18
				 
				
				
				声望力: 18 ![]()  | 
	
	
	
		
		
			
			 
			
			以为是SOLVE的问题,最后搞了半天发现是你的问题。
		 
		
		
		
		
		
		
		
	 | 
| 
		 | 
	
	
	
		
		
		
		
			 
		
		
		
		
		
		
		
			
		
		
		
	 | 
| 		
			
			 | 
		#3 | 
| 
			
			 初级会员 
			
			
			
			注册日期: 2008-05-22 
				
				年龄: 45 
				
					帖子: 2
				 
				
				
				声望力: 0 ![]()  | 
	
	
	
		
		
			
			 
			
			LZ程序是不是给错了。第一个方程怎么会有1,1,1的解。
		 
		
		
		
		
		
		
		
	 | 
| 
		 | 
	
	
	
		
		
		
		
			 
		
		
		
		
		
		
		
			
		
		
		
	 | 
| 		
			
			 | 
		#4 | 
| 
			
			 初级会员 
			
			
			
			注册日期: 2008-05-23 
				
				年龄: 39 
				
					帖子: 5
				 
				
				
				声望力: 0 ![]()  | 
	
	
	
		
		
			
			 
			
			:tongue: LZ算得的结果很明显是正确的啊,怎么会有1 1 1这一组解呢,代入方程后肯定不正确啊
		 
		
		
		
		
		
		
		
	 | 
| 
		 | 
	
	
	
		
		
		
		
			 
		
		
		
		
		
		
		
			
		
		
		
	 | 
![]()  | 
	
	
		
  | 
	
		 | 
			 
			相似的主题
		 | 
	||||
| 主题 | 主题作者 | 版面 | 回复 | 最后发表 | 
| [求助]关于Matlab和VC6.0混合编程问题 | jiazhaohui | MATLAB论坛 | 1 | 2008-08-07 21:43 | 
| 【求助】怎样生成如下[a a a b b b c c c d d d]数据? | wanghaiuestc | MATLAB论坛 | 2 | 2007-08-14 12:01 |